Impact
A remote attacker can manipulate parameters used by the iux_set.cgi web component, enabling execution of arbitrary operating system commands on the device. The flaw allows remote code execution, which can compromise confidentiality, integrity, and availability of the affected system. The weakness is a classic OS command injection, as identified by CWE-77 and CWE-78.
Affected Systems
The vulnerability affects EFM ipTIME C200E routers running firmware version 1.094. No other versions or products are indicated as impacted.
Risk and Exploitability
The CVSS score of 9.4 indicates critical severity. The EPSS score is not available, and the v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og. The attack vector is remote, likely via HTTP requests to the /iux_set.cgi endpoint, and can be performed without authentication according to the publicly disclosed exploit. Remediation requires firmware updates or mitigations until a patch is released.
